The University of Cincinnati offers a Master of Engineering in Artificial Intelligence through its College of Engineering and Applied Science. The 30-credit, non-thesis program is designed around applied AI and can be completed in approximately 12 months.
The curriculum has a strong machine learning focus. Required coursework includes artificial intelligence, deep learning, and intelligent systems, while electives include machine learning, advanced machine learning, generative AI, information retrieval, and machine learning techniques for engineers.
Students also complete an industry-focused capstone, which can be fulfilled through an internship. This makes UC a strong option for students who want a practical AI degree rather than a research-heavy master’s program.

Machine Learning and AI Curriculum
The curriculum makes the program a clear fit for students comparing machine learning master’s degrees. UC requires three AI courses and at least four AI electives, along with professional engineering coursework and a capstone.
Required AI Courses
- CS 6033 Artificial Intelligence
- CS 6073 Deep Learning
- EECE 6036 Intelligent Systems
AI and Machine Learning Electives
- AEEM 6088 Machine Learning Techniques for Engineers
- AEEM 6097 Soft Computing Based AI
- CS 6037 Machine Learning
- CS 6054 Information Retrieval
- CS 6078 Generative Artificial Intelligence
- CS 6101 Introduction to Applied Artificial Intelligence and Machine Learning Tools
- CS 7063 Advanced Methods in Machine Learning
- EECE 6064 Applied Generative AI: A Deep Learning Approach Across Modalities
- EECE 7065 Complex Systems and Networks
Students choose four or more courses from the approved elective list. Additional electives may be approved by an adviser.
In addition to technical AI coursework, students complete professional engineering requirements in project or task management and interpersonal skills. These courses support the program’s emphasis on technical leadership and applied work.

Capstone and Applied Experience
The degree includes a required Master of Engineering capstone. Students complete 3 to 6 credit hours of approved capstone work, depending on the course and project structure.
UC states that the capstone is built around an authentic industry problem and may be fulfilled as an internship. This applied requirement gives students an opportunity to use machine learning and AI methods on a real technical problem before graduation.
Program Length and Format
UC lists the Artificial Intelligence MEng as a one-year program. The university’s MEng structure can include two semesters of coursework followed by another semester devoted to an internship or capstone project.
The official Artificial Intelligence program page presents this degree as a Cincinnati campus program. UC offers online formats for some MEng degrees, but the university does not currently identify this specific AI MEng as an online program. Students seeking a fully online degree should confirm delivery options directly with UC before applying.
Tuition and Cost
For the 2026–27 academic year, the University of Cincinnati lists standard graduate tuition for Ohio residents at $746 per credit hour for part-time enrollment. The College of Engineering and Applied Science also carries a graduate program fee of $51 per credit hour for part-time students.
That produces a listed part-time Ohio-resident rate of $797 per credit before any other applicable charges.
For full-time graduate enrollment, UC lists standard graduate tuition of $7,451 per term and a CEAS program fee of $504 per term, for a combined listed amount of $7,955 per full-time term before other applicable charges.
Nonresident students may pay an additional surcharge, and actual program cost depends on enrollment pattern and the number of full-time and part-time terms used to complete the degree. Students should use UC’s current tuition schedule when estimating total cost.

Admissions
UC states that applicants should hold a bachelor’s degree in engineering, engineering technology, computer science, or a closely related field and generally have a 3.0 or higher GPA.
The GRE requirement depends on the applicant’s academic background. The program page states that GRE scores are required when an applicant has a GPA below 3.0, does not hold a bachelor’s degree in engineering or computer science, or earned the bachelor’s degree outside the United States.
UC’s graduate admissions FAQ also lists the Artificial Intelligence MEng among programs with GRE requirements for Fall 2026 and Spring 2027, while providing an exemption for qualifying students with a U.S. ABET-accredited bachelor’s degree and a GPA of at least 3.0. Applicants should check the current program-specific rules because GRE policies can change by admission cycle.
International applicants must also meet UC’s English proficiency requirements. The CEAS graduate application fee is currently $75 for domestic applicants and $80 for international applicants.

What Makes Cincinnati’s AI Program Different?
Direct AI and Machine Learning Curriculum
The degree is specifically named Artificial Intelligence rather than Computer Science or Data Science. Required courses include AI, deep learning, and intelligent systems, and students can build further depth through several machine learning and generative AI electives.
One-Year Professional Structure
UC designed the MEng for students who want to move into technical industry roles quickly. The 30-credit, non-thesis structure can be completed in about one year.
Industry-Focused Capstone
The required capstone focuses on a real industry problem and can be completed through an internship. This gives the program a practical focus that differs from thesis-centered master’s degrees.
Is the University of Cincinnati MEng in Artificial Intelligence Worth Considering?
The University of Cincinnati’s MEng in Artificial Intelligence is a strong option for students who want a short, applied graduate degree centered directly on AI and machine learning.
The curriculum is the main reason to consider it. Students take required courses in artificial intelligence, deep learning, and intelligent systems and can choose from several machine learning, advanced machine learning, generative AI, and information retrieval electives.
The one-year structure and applied capstone also make the program attractive for students focused on industry careers rather than academic research.
The main tradeoff is that students looking for a thesis, a research-focused master’s path, or a clearly documented fully online option may prefer another program.
Who Is This Program Best For?
Best for: Students with engineering or computer science backgrounds who want a focused, one-year professional master’s degree with substantial machine learning and AI coursework.
Consider another program if: You want a thesis-based research degree, a clearly established fully online format, or a longer program with more room for academic specialization.
